On Gandhi Jayanti, a 2019 video of Samajwadi Party leaders is cracking up the internet. Amused by the 21-second clip, many X users even went into the details and spotted a couple of ‘netas’ laughing too. But what’s the video about?

In the clip, which has been viewed by over 51,000 people, a leader from Akhilesh Yadav’s party can be seen holding a garlanded statue of Mahatma Gandhi and weeping, while others pat his back and try to console him. A couple of leaders present in the frame can be seen giggling.

How Old Is The Video? Where Did This Happen & Who Are The Leaders?

The original video is a minute long, and was shot on On October 2, 2019. It was filmed when Firoz Khan, the district unit president of Samajwadi Party, gathered at the Gandhi statue at Fawara Chowk in Chandausi in Uttar Pradesh’s Sambhal district.

The SP workers and local leaders, led by Khan, arrived at the location to pay tribute on Mahatma Gandhi’s 150th birth anniversary.

Firoz Khan, while expressing sorrow over Mahatma Gandhi’s assassination, began crying and said, “Desh azad karakar Bapu kahan chalegaye aap”.

Shortly, the one-minute video went viral, with social media users trolling the then SP district unit president. The social media trolls labeled Khan as the “best nominee” for an Oscar award.

After the viral spread of the video, Khan faced intense criticism from various parties, primarily the BJP, which accused him of disrespecting Mahatma Gandhi by shedding “crocodile tears.”

“His eyes were dry, and he was merely dishonoring Gandhiji. Furthermore, it was not Gandhi’s death anniversary but his birth anniversary, which was being celebrated nationwide with great enthusiasm. Yet, the SP leader and his workers were mourning like banshees, which is repulsive,” a Times of India report quoted BJP district unit president, Om Veer Singh, as saying.

What Did Firoz Khan Say After His Video Went Viral?

In his defence, Khan said that he was pained to see Gandhi’s statue covered in dust, which moved him to tears.

He questioned BJP leaders, accusing them of hypocrisy and demanding they clarify their loyalty to either Gandhi or Godse.

Other Controversies Of SP Leader Firoz Khan

Months before this viral video, Firoz Khan hit headlines for dressing as a groom with his face covered in a “sehara”. He managed to enter Rampur, avoiding police security.

The police had sealed the borders of Rampur where SP president Akhilesh Yadav had come to support Azam Khan, who then faced multiple land grab charges. Before this, during the Lok Sabha elections in May 2019, Khan had sparked controversy with inappropriate and sexist comments against BJP candidate Jaya Prada, who contested from the Rampur seat.
